Detect common N55 problems using OBD2 Scantool?

Hello.

As I have gathered the N55 engine has a few common problems Source
1. High level of oil consumption in N55. Such problem is mainly caused by crankcase vent valve (PCV). Check it first of all.
2. Misfire. Such malfunction is likely to result in carbonized hydraulic lifters. Check them and use high quality engine oil.
3. Engine vibration. It can result in the fact that fuel injectors are out of order. The duration period is about 80,000 km (50,000 miles) of mileage. All you need is to replace them to make motor operate properly.
4) In addition the problem with high pressure fuel pump (HPFP), still exists in N55 engines. The pump may get out of order regularly
Is any of these problems specifically detectable using an OBD Scantool? I have the Autel MaxiDiag MD805, I don't have access to another BMW for comparison but on my diesel Volvo it was capable of getting live data from about 30+ native modules as well as eOBD. So I recon it will be able to get some HPFP and VANOS-data, but I have no idea what the correct value is suppose to look like. If missfires occur that will sure show but it would be good to have an idea for other "target" parameters. Only thing I know to check specifically now is that the abs sensors report the sameish value and of course reading system wide error codes.

Here is my 2 cents.

When buying a new car i want to make sure that there are no Major issues. Even if you could detect that the injectors are not good, its not really a reason to not buy a car it would me more of a price haggle thing..

So To answer your question the sophisticated devices that can read all PID sensors through the CAN protocol will give you alot of information and people on this forum will recommend the Schwaben tool but i dont think these tools are necessary for detecting major issues.

The issues you listed are not major and not a reason again not o buy the car.

What i recommend is that you do a compression test. Check fluid condition.

Listen for odd noises and if you can use a tool check the oil pressure at normal operating oil temperature.

Oil Pressure tells you alot.

Got the target oil pressures for the N55 Engine from a BMW workshop:

At normal operating oil temperature:
Idle: min 1.5 bar = 150kPa = 21,7 psi.
During drive: 4-6 Bar = 400-600 kPa = 58-87 psi.

Super interesting to see So the idle should be a lot lower compared to the Volvo but the running pressure is about the same as I experienced.

Very normal values. 87 max tells me that most likely weight 40 oil is used. Like maybe 0w-40 or 5w-40.

We get these parameters for the E90 platform with MHD monitoring.
